Wavelet theory [[electronic resource] ] : an elementary approach with applications / / David K. Ruch, Patrick J. Van Fleet
Wavelet theory [[electronic resource] ] : an elementary approach with applications / / David K. Ruch, Patrick J. Van Fleet
Autore Ruch David K. <1959->
Pubbl/distr/stampa Hoboken, N.J., : John Wiley & Sons, 2009
Descrizione fisica 1 online resource (502 p.)
Disciplina 515.2433
Altri autori (Persone) Van FleetPatrick J. <1962->
Soggetto topico Wavelets (Mathematics)
Transformations (Mathematics)
Digital images - Mathematics
Soggetto genere / forma Electronic books.
ISBN 1-283-28001-9
9786613280015
1-118-16565-9
1-118-16566-7
Formato Materiale a stampa
Livello bibliografico Monografia
Lingua di pubblicazione eng
Nota di contenuto Wavelet Theory: An Elementary Approach with Applications; CONTENTS; Preface; Acknowledgments; 1 The Complex Plane and the Space L2(R); 1.1 Complex Numbers and Basic Operations; Problems; 1.2 The Space L2(R); Problems; 1.3 Inner Products; Problems; 1.4 Bases and Projections; Problems; 2 Fourier Series and Fourier Transformations; 2.1 Euler's Formula and the Complex Exponential Function; Problems; 2.2 Fourier Series; Problems; 2.3 The Fourier Transform; Problems; 2.4 Convolution and 5-Splines; Problems; 3 Haar Spaces; 3.1 The Haar Space Vo; Problems; 3.2 The General Haar Space Vj; Problems
3.3 The Haar Wavelet Space W0Problems; 3.4 The General Haar Wavelet Space Wj; Problems; 3.5 Decomposition and Reconstruction; Problems; 3.6 Summary; 4 The Discrete Haar Wavelet Transform and Applications; 4.1 The One-Dimensional Transform; Problems; 4.2 The Two-Dimensional Transform; Problems; 4.3 Edge Detection and Naive Image Compression; 5 Multiresolution Analysis; 5.1 Multiresolution Analysis; Problems; 5.2 The View from the Transform Domain; Problems; 5.3 Examples of Multiresolution Analyses; Problems; 5.4 Summary; 6 Daubechies Scaling Functions and Wavelets
6.1 Constructing the Daubechies Scaling FunctionsProblems; 6.2 The Cascade Algorithm; Problems; 6.3 Orthogonal Translates, Coding, and Projections; Problems; 7 The Discrete Daubechies Transformation and Applications; 7.1 The Discrete Daubechies Wavelet Transform; Problems; 7.2 Projections and Signal and Image Compression; Problems; 7.3 Naive Image Segmentation; Problems; 8 Biorthogonal Scaling Functions and Wavelets; 8.1 A Biorthogonal Example and Duality; Problems; 8.2 Biorthogonality Conditions for Symbols and Wavelet Spaces; Problems
8.3 Biorthogonal Spline Filter Pairs and the CDF97 Filter PairProblems; 8.4 Decomposition and Reconstruction; Problems; 8.5 The Discrete Biorthogonal Wavelet Transform; Problems; 8.6 Riesz Basis Theory; Problems; 9 Wavelet Packets; 9.1 Constructing Wavelet Packet Functions; Problems; 9.2 Wavelet Packet Spaces; Problems; 9.3 The Discrete Packet Transform and Best Basis Algorithm; Problems; 9.4 The FBI Fingerprint Compression Standard; Appendix A: Huffman Coding; Problems; References; Topic Index; Author Index
